Job Purpose
The Bridge Hall Manager is responsible for the effective day-to-day management and operation of The Bridge Hall and its associated facilities. The postholder will oversee venue bookings, support hirers and users, manage performances and events, coordinate marketing and ticketing activities, and ensure the smooth running of all venue operations.
Working closely with the Venue Programmer, Bridge Trust staff, volunteers, artists, promoters, and community organisations, the Hall Manager will play a key role in delivering a successful programme of events and activities while maintaining high standards of customer service, administration, and venue management.
Key Responsibilities
Venue and Booking Management
- Manage all bookings for The Bridge Hall, classrooms, meeting spaces, and associated facilities.
- Maintain and oversee the venue booking calendar, ensuring efficient and effective use of all spaces.
- Act as the primary point of contact for hirers, responding to enquiries and supporting users throughout the booking process.
- Ensure booking information is accurately recorded and communicated to relevant staff and volunteers.
- Develop and maintain positive relationships with venue users, community groups, performers, and external organisations.
Event and Performance Management
- Undertake Duty Management responsibilities for performances, events, and activities taking place within the venue.
- Oversee the smooth running of events, ensuring a high-quality experience for audiences, performers, hirers, and venue users.
- Coordinate event logistics with performers, promoters, technicians, hirers, staff, and volunteers.
- Work closely with the Venue Programmer to ensure all booked events are successfully delivered, coordinating operational, technical, marketing, and administrative requirements to realise the programme effectively and provide a positive experience for artists, hirers, audiences, and venue users.
- Create and manage staffing rotas for stewards, technicians, and event support staff to ensure appropriate coverage for all performances and events.
- Brief stewards, technicians, volunteers, and event staff before performances and events, ensuring they are fully informed of event requirements, health and safety procedures, customer service expectations, and emergency protocols.
- Monitor event delivery and address operational issues as they arise.
- Ensure appropriate procedures and venue policies are followed during events and performances.
Box Office and Ticketing
- Set up performances, events, and activities on the TicketSource box office system.
- Monitor ticket sales and provide reports and information as required.
- Support customers with ticketing enquiries and resolve box office issues in a timely and professional manner.
- Liaise with promoters, performers, and hirers regarding ticketing arrangements and sales information.
Marketing and Promotion
- Promote events, performances, and venue activities through the venue website, Facebook pages, and other appropriate marketing channels.
- Maintain and update online event listings and venue information.
- Work with the Venue Programmer and event organisers to maximise attendance and audience engagement.
- Assist in developing and delivering marketing campaigns that support venue activity and community engagement.
Leadership and Team Coordination
- Lead regular team meetings and operational briefings.
- Liaise closely with Bridge Trust staff, volunteers, and external stakeholders to ensure effective communication and coordination.
- Liaise with concession management with regards to any security staff requirements, event details and requests form hirers.
- Coordinate and deploy stewarding, technical, and volunteer teams to support the successful delivery of performances and events.
- Provide clear direction and support to staff and volunteers during events, acting as the key operational contact and ensuring effective communication throughout.
- Support, motivate, and coordinate volunteers involved in venue activities and events.
- Foster a positive, collaborative, and customer-focused working environment.
Administration and Financial Processes
- Prepare and manage venue hire contracts, performance agreements, settlement sheets, and other event-related documentation.
- Ensure accurate records are maintained for bookings, events, contracts, and financial transactions.
- Work closely with administration and finance staff to communicate information relating to venue users, hirers, performances, and financial arrangements.
- Support the preparation of operational reports and documentation as required.
- Assist with post-event settlements and financial reconciliation processes.
Compliance and Venue Operations
- Ensure the venue operates in accordance with health and safety requirements, licensing regulations, and organisational policies.
- Assist in maintaining a safe, welcoming, and professional environment for all users.
- Report maintenance issues and liaise with appropriate personnel or contractors to ensure facilities remain fit for purpose.
- Support the ongoing development and improvement of venue operations and services.
